Ingredients

Air fryer calzones are a delicious, handheld meal that combines a crispy golden crust with a savory filling of turkey bacon, chicken ham, cheese, and fresh vegetables. Quick, versatile, and satisfying, they are perfect for lunches, dinners, or snacks.

For the Dough

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on instant yeast
  • ¾ cup warm water

For the Filling

  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½ cup cooked chicken ham, diced
  • ½ cup turkey bacon, cooked and chopped
  • ½ cup diced bell peppers
  • ½ cup sliced mushrooms
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ano

For Finishing Touches

  • 1 egg (for egg wash)

How to Make Air Fryer Calzones

Step 1: Combine Dry Ingredients

In a large bowl, mix together the flour, salt, sugar, and instant yeast until well blended.

Step 2: Add Wet Ingredients

Make a well in the center of your dry mixture. Pour in the warm water and olive oil. Stir until a dough begins to form.

Step 3: Knead Dough

Transfer the dough to a floured surface. Knead it for about 8–10 minutes until it becomes smooth and elastic.

Step 4: Let Dough Rise

Place your kneaded dough into an oiled bowl. Cover it with a cloth or plastic wrap and let it rise for 1–1.5 hours or until it has doubled in size.

Step 5: Prepare Fillings

While your dough is rising, cook the turkey bacon until crispy. Chop up the chicken ham. Dice bell peppers and slice mushrooms. In a mixing bowl, combine all these fillings along with mozzarella cheese, garlic powder, and oregano.

Step 6: Divide Dough

After rising, punch down your dough gently to release any air bubbles. Divide it into 6 equal portions. Roll each portion into a circle about 6 inches in diameter.

Step 7: Assemble Calzones

Take one circle of dough and place some filling on one half of it. Fold the other half over to cover the filling and seal the edges by crimping them with a fork.

Step 8: Apply Egg Wash

Brush the tops of each calzone with beaten egg. This will give them a beautiful golden finish when cooked.

Step 9: Preheat Air Fryer

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for about 3–5 minutes before cooking your calzones.

Step 10: Cook Calzones

Place two or three calzones in your air fryer basket (depending on size) and cook them for about 12–15 minutes or until they are golden brown. Flip them halfway through if needed for even browning.

Step 11: Serve

Once done, allow your air fryer calzones to cool slightly before serving them with your favorite dipping sauce like marinara or ranch dressing. Enjoy!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making air fryer calzones can be fun and rewarding, but it’s easy to make mistakes that can affect the outcome. Here are some common pitfalls and how to steer clear of them.

  • Skipping the Dough Rise: Not allowing the dough to rise properly can lead to tough calzones. Always let the dough double in size for the best texture.
  • Overstuffing the Filling: Adding too much filling can cause spills during cooking. Stick to a moderate amount of filling for each calzone to ensure they seal well.
  • Not Preheating the Air Fryer: Failing to preheat your air fryer may result in uneven cooking. Always preheat for a few minutes to achieve that perfect golden crust.
  • Ignoring Egg Wash: Skipping egg wash leads to dull-looking calzones. Brush the tops with beaten egg for a shiny, appetizing finish.
  • Cooking Too Many at Once: Overcrowding the air fryer basket prevents proper cooking. Air fry in batches for optimal crispiness.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store calzones in an airtight container.
  • They will last up to 3 days in the fridge.

Freezing Air Fryer Calzones

  • Wrap each calzone individually in plastic wrap.
  •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container, and they will keep for up to 2 months.

Reheating Air Fryer Calzones

  • Oven: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and heat for about 10-15 minutes until warm.
  • Microwave: Heat on medium power for 1-2 minutes, checking periodically so they don’t get soggy.
  • Stovetop: Heat in a skillet over medium-low heat for about 5 minutes, flipping occasionally until warmed through.
